Bajaj Pulsar 125 color image gallery

The Pulsar 125 is the most affordable and accessible Pulsar one can buy in Bajaj’s line-up. It still manages to strike a neat balance between looks and performance. The Pulsar 125 is a sporty commuter which now resembles the design of the P150, but also carries its iconic design silhouette from the 2000s with modern updates.

Bajaj updated the model in January 2026, and it is now available in 3 variants: Neon Single Seat, Carbon Fibre Single Seat and Carbon Fibre Split Seat. The Neon is the base variant among the three. It comes equipped with a halogen bulb and indicator setup, semi digital instrument cluster and misses out on the belly pan. On the other hand, The Carbon Fibre edition offers two seating options, single and split seat setup and is equipped with modern features like a fully digital instrument console with Bluetooth connectivity and USB charging port. The design is also sportier with the addition of a belly pan and updated with striking graphics

The Pulsar 125 is powered by a 124cc, single-cylinder, 4-stroke motor producing 11.8hp of power  and 10.8Nm of torque and is available in 4 colour schemes across the 3 variants. The Pulsar 125 rivals in the sporty commuter segment which includes the TVS Raider, Honda SP125, Hero Xtreme 125R and the CB Hornet 125
